Listed by Morton Crows NestA home of exceptional design and enduring quality, this custom-built residence was created to embrace the essence of family living across generations. Every element has been thoughtfully considered, from the separation of living zones to the seamless connection between indoor comfort and outdoor luxury. Whether it's accommodating extended family, entertaining friends, or simply enjoying peaceful moments of retreat, this property offers a lifestyle defined by space, privacy and effortless functionality.
- Master retreat privately positioned with large walk-in robe, lavish ensuite and direct access to the gym and sauna wing
- Bedroom wing includes three spacious bedrooms with built-ins, family bathroom and powder room, plus a separate guest suite ideal for multi-generational accommodation
- 2.7m ceilings throughout with an impressive 3.2m high entry void enhancing light and space
- Home theatre featuring surround sound, Epsom 4K recessed projector, 120-inch screen, custom cabinetry and four leather recliners on raised platform
- Chef's kitchen with 60mm Caesarstone benchtops, custom cabinetry, built-in Westinghouse freezer, multi-functional wall ovens including steamer, microwave and integrated coffee machine
- Separate study and home office, ideal for dual remote work setups
- Family area featuring a built-in bar, direct patio access and adjoining play area - Perfect for entertaining, family relaxation or a versatile study and creative zone
- Outdoor entertaining pavilion with built-in BBQ, woodfire pizza oven, woodfire grill, bar fridge and stone benchtop
- Saltwater pool and spa with in-built self-cleaning system, electric heating and provisions for solar heating
- Gym, sauna and pavilion overlooking the pool, perfect for year-round wellness and leisure
- Half-sized soccer field with LED floodlights for family recreation or training
- Triple remote-control garage with internal access and parking for six additional cars
- Fully irrigated grounds with pop-up sprinkler system to lawns, drip irrigation to garden beds, and dedicated rainwater tank
- Ducted vacuum, split system and reverse-cycle air conditioning for climate comfort throughout
- External security including CCTV, motion detector sensor lights, alarm system and intercom with front door camera
